删除单元格Excel VBA完整入门教程

删除单元格功能是 Excel VBA 中常见的操作之一,尤其在动态表格数据时,能够快速清理不必要的单元格方便。删除单元格其实跟剪切操作挺像,只不过这里会涉及到下方或右侧单元格的移动。你可以使用Range.Delete方法,配合Shift参数来控制删除后的单元格如何,挺灵活的。

比如说,你要删除A1单元格的内容,并让下面的单元格上移,可以直接使用下面的代码:

[a1].Delete Shift:=xlUp

这样 A1 就会被删除,A2:A10 会自动向上移。其实这也跟手动删除一个单元格时的操作差不多,适合用在数据清理、数据重排等场景中。

需要注意的是,删除单元格时要小心,如果不当会导致数据错乱,是当你在循环或批量操作时,要先做好备份。,删除单元格是 Excel 中基础但却实用的操作,掌握了它,你的数据操作会更加灵活。

pdf 文件大小:1.72MB